People have been tossing the rumor that KITT would become a 2010 Mustang? Maybe there is some truth to that at least temporary?

From http://www.ecorazzi.com/2008/11/17/knig ... n-upgrade/" onclick="window.open(this.href);return false;:
It looks like Wednesday night, however, we might see a new fuel-efficient KITT hit the road. Here’s the preview from NBC:

The government dispatches a green consultant to the SSC, in order to evaluate the KITT Cave’s carbon deficiency. The consultant turns out to have had a history with Graiman. She also challenges Graiman to defend and explain KITT’s “green” status, and Graiman reveals the next generation of KITT.

Might we see another hydrogen-powered KITT? How about we drop the Mustang and go with an all-electric Fisker Karma?
Though our summary from NBC on the episode was:
MIKE, KITT AND BILLY HEAD TO VEGAS TO TAKE ON A MONEY LAUNDERING RING -- Mike (Justin Bruening) goes undercover in Vegas to bust a money laundering operation. Billy (Paul Campbell) joins Mike and KITT (voiced by Val Kilmer) on the mission, only to spark a romantic adventure of his own. Meanwhile, Dr. Graiman (Bruce Davison) locks horns with an old rival and former flame, who comes to assess how “green” the KITT Cave is.
I guess we'll find out tomorrow!
